以下では、EXCEL ドキュメントを生成するための PHP 実装プログラムをいくつか紹介します。必要な方は参考にしてください。
オリジナルの書き方
元の方法: ヘッダーを送信し、添付ファイルのヘッダーを使用してダウンロードすることをユーザーのブラウザーに送信し、データベース内のデータを読み取り、1 つずつ解析し、ファイルに書き込みます。エクセル形式
コードは次のとおりです | コードをコピー | ||||||||
$DB_Server = "ローカルホスト";
$DB_ユーザー名 = "ルート";
$DB_Password = "" PHPExcelライブラリの使用 以下はPHPExcelを使って上記と同じ機能を持つExcelを実装する方法です。 getCol は、番号に基づいて対応する列番号コードを返すために使用される再帰的に実装された関数です。エクスポート処理中に行番号と列番号を指定する必要があるためです。行番号は単純な数字ですが、列番号は「A ~ Z」の組み合わせです。二次元配列のインポートを容易にするために、列番号コードは列数に基づいて自動的に取得されます 使用説明書: 1. 次のコードを Excel.php として保存し、ページ上で呼び出します。 2. 次に、xlsBOF() を呼び出し、xlswritenunber() または xlswritelabel() にコンテンツを書き込み、最後に xlsEOF() を呼び出して終了します。 echo を使用してブラウザ上に表示するだけの代わりに、fwrite 関数を使用してサーバーに直接書き込むこともできます。 以下は PHP コードです:
前の記事:ユーザー IP と地理的位置を取得するための PHP タオバオ IP データ_PHP チュートリアル
次の記事:PHP 完全なページング クラス (ソース コード付き)_PHP チュートリアル
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
著者別の最新記事
最新の問題
URL パラメータから取得した PHP 配列が期待どおりに動作しない
カテゴリ ID を含む URL パラメータがあり、それを次のような配列として扱いたいと考えています: http://example.com?cat[]=3,9,13 PHP では、...
から 2024-04-06 22:09:02
0
1
1428
戻り値の変数の形式は何ですか?
私はphpの初心者です。コードを見つけました: if($x<time()){return[false,'error'];} ロジックや変数は重要ではありませんが、[false...
から 2024-04-06 21:55:20
0
1
778
ループするために MySQL の結果を ID ごとにグループ化する
mysqlにフライトデータを含むテーブルがあります。 codeigniter3Journey_idair_idFlightDurationout_or_inflightdurati...
から 2024-04-06 17:27:56
0
1
406
関連トピック
詳細>
|